sardar-muhammad-masood-khanISLAMABAD, December 16: President, Azad Jammu and Kashmir Sardar Masood Khan on Friday urged Pakistani students to continue their political and moral support with Kashmiri youth and play their vital role to highlight Kashmir issue.
Addressing the annual convocation and degree award ceremony of the Preston University in Islamabad, he urged the students to highlight Kashmir cause through social media to express solidarity with the people of Kashmir. As many as 400 male and female students of the Preston University have been awarded with degrees in different categories including MA, MS, M.Phil. Chancellor, Preston University Dr Abdul Basit, faculty members, a large number of students and parents also attended the convocation ceremony. President AJK further said, “It was the era of nano science” adding that, “Pakistan can progress only by adopting it.” He expressed the hope that, “The United Kingdom would condemn human rights violations and atrocities by Indian forces in Indian Occupied Kashmir.” The AJK President said, “India was committing gross human rights violations in occupied Kashmir and the entire population was living under extended curfew for over a month now.” Masood Khan also urged the Britain government, Norway and other countries to link their trade contracts with India with peaceful resolution of Kashmir dispute. He appealed to the international community to come forward and play its vital role to end the rights abuses and resolve the issue according to the UN resolutions on Kashmir and in the light of the aspiration of Kashmiri people. – DNA
